Package: evolution
Version: 3.4.4-4+b1
Severity: important
Dear Maintainer,
Starting evolution has ceased to work after recent updates.
The problem seems to be related to clutter, but I am not
a gnome user, so I cannot be sure.
I usually use evolution under KDE, and there, I get this:

This may be related to #710828 but I am using a local system
and glxgears works just fine (I use nvidia proprietary drivers,
in case that matters).
It may also be related to #659394 (on libclutter-1.0-0:amd64), but
I don't get a segmentation fault as far as I can see.
